Subject: [PATCH 4/7] Input: sx8654 - add sx8655 and sx8656 to compatibles

As the sx865[456] share the same datasheet and differ only in the
presence of a "capacitive proximity detection circuit" and a "haptics
motor driver for LRA/ERM" add them to the compatbiles. As the driver
doesn't implement these features it should be no problem.

drivers/input/touchscreen/sx8654.c | 4 ++++
1 file changed, 4 insertions(+)
diff --git a/drivers/input/touchscreen/sx8654.c b/drivers/input/touchscreen/sx8654.c
index 059127490c8d..622283b49d7c 100644
--- a/drivers/input/touchscreen/sx8654.c
+++ b/drivers/input/touchscreen/sx8654.c
@@ -222,6 +222,8 @@ static int sx8654_get_ofdata(struct sx8654 *ts)
static const struct of_device_id sx8654_of_match[] = {
{ .compatible = "semtech,sx8654", },
+ { .compatible = "semtech,sx8655", },
+ { .compatible = "semtech,sx8656", },
{ },
};
M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(of, sx8654_of_match);
@@ -326,6 +328,8 @@ static int sx8654_probe(struct i2c_client *client,
static const struct i2c_device_id sx8654_id_table[] = {
{ "semtech_sx8654", 0 },
+ { "semtech_sx8655", 0 },
+ { "semtech_sx8656", 0 },
{ },
};
M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(i2c, sx8654_id_table);
